Finance Review Summary — Churn in the Lanthorn Pilot

Prepared for heads of department. The Lanthorn subscription pilot recorded 14% customer churn in its second quarter, above the 9% threshold set at launch. Exit surveys cite onboarding friction and pricing confusion at the mid tier. Revenue retention remains acceptable at 91% due to upgrades. We recommend pausing expansion pending remediation. The confidential plan affected by these findings follows below.

internal memo for kawip-hadug: Headcount on the Wenwyn team goes from 7 to 140 by the end of January. Gross margin on Wenwyn came in at 20 percent against a plan of 15 percent.

### Runbook: Branchreaper Cleanup Bot

Branchreaper deletes stale branches in the Hollowfen monorepo nightly. For security review: the bot runs with a scoped token, cannot touch protected branches, and logs every deletion to the audit stream. Dry-run mode is forced in any environment lacking audit connectivity. Deletions are reversible for 30 days. It operates under the following configuration values.

deployment values, tafof-taduf:
pelius:
  pin: 6508
  tenant: praiel
  seal: seal_4e33a2f4
  metrics_host: metrics.pelius.plorvagrid.corp
  standby_team: druix
  escalation: juldor-norius
  nonce: 5db598

## Report Exports: Timezone Handling

Vexport renders all report timestamps in UTC, then converts at export time using the tenant's configured zone. Do not trust the browser locale — it's ignored on purpose. If a customer reports shifted rows, check the tenant zone first, then the DST table version. Export bundles are signed before delivery; verify signatures with the release key shown below.

signing key of yajog-kafof = bky19_orbYRY3Abj3KpZesMie

Subject: Seat-map renderer fix is out

Hi support folks — the Velvetine seat-map renderer no longer collapses balcony rows on narrow screens. If a venue reports overlapping seats, have them hard-refresh; cached layouts clear themselves within an hour otherwise. Nothing else changed. The rollout corresponds to the build noted below.

build token for kagaf-hahof: htk14_9d3d4d26d7d8de